The Hogan assessment is a series of personality tests used by employers to screen job candidates. You may be required to take any combination of the three but the HPI is the most popular Hogan assessment among recruiters, the HDS is the second most used, and the MVPI is the least used among the three. For example, answering Agree to a question that asks whether others take advantage of you might disqualify you for a managerial position but position you for an assistant role.
